Как устроены базы данных и зачем они нужны

  • Home
  • Uncategorized
  • Как устроены базы данных и зачем они нужны

Как устроены базы данных и зачем они нужны

Базы данных представляют собой систематизированные хранилища информации, которые эксплуатируются почти во всех современных цифровых структурах. Каждый день множества человек работают с базами данных, даже не подозревая об этом. Когда пользователь открывает социальную сеть, совершает покупку в интернет-магазине или проверяет состояние карты, за кулисами действуют комплексные структуры управления информацией.

Ключевая миссия базы данных выражается в упорядочении и размещении огромных объёмов данных. Сведения находятся в определённых схемах, которые позволяют стремительно отыскивать необходимые сведения. up x обеспечивает не только удержание, но и эффективную переработку информации.

Современные базы данных сформированы по схеме матриц, где данные размещается по записям и столбцам. Выделенные системы организуют обращением к информации и наблюдают за согласованностью информации. ап икс официальный сайт обеспечивает составлять многоуровневые команды для приобретения требуемой данных за доли секунды.

Что такое база данных и её ключевое предназначение

База данных — это систематизированная собрание информации, подготовленная для эффективного содержания, извлечения и обработки. Такие системы содержат организованные сведения о пользователях, изделиях, платежах и прочих объектах. Информация хранится в систематизированном виде, что даёт возможность стремительно приобретать доступ к необходимым строкам.

Основное назначение базы данных состоит в единообразном управлении данными. Вместо сохранения информации в обособленных массивах учреждения задействуют централизованное хранилище. ап икс облегчает взаимодействие с данными и устраняет размножение записей.

Базы данных выполняют цель многопользовательского обращения к данным. Несколько специалистов могут параллельно трудиться с аналогичными и теми же сведениями без коллизий. up x подтверждает непротиворечивость информации даже при значительной загрузке.

Актуальные базы данных гарантируют безопасность содержания критически важной данных. Средства архивного сохранения оберегают данные от потери при сбоях оборудования.

Упорядочение сведений в структурированном формате

Упорядочение данных является собой основополагающий принцип работы баз данных. Сведения распределяются по матрицам, где каждая строка содержит самостоятельную элемент, а поля задают свойства единиц. Такая организация помогает последовательно группировать однотипную информацию.

Каждая таблица в базе данных имеет точную схему с установленными параметрами. Поле является собой обособленный атрибут строки, например имя покупателя или стоимость продукта. Предоставляет единообразие содержания данных и облегчает её управление.

Систематизированная организация сведений вмещает несколько ключевых частей:

  • Главные идентификаторы для единственной идентификации строк
  • Виды данных для контроля типа сведений
  • Индексы для ускорения нахождения по матрицам
  • Требования непротиворечивости для устранения неточностей

Верная схема базы данных предотвращает повторение сведений. Уменьшает размер содержащихся данных и оптимизирует изменение. Упорядочение таблиц устраняет копирование.

Размещение огромных количеств сведений и стремительный обращение к ним

Современные базы данных в состоянии размещать терабайты и петабайты данных. Значительные предприятия аккумулируют миллиарды данных о заказчиках и платежах. up x совершенствует использование дискового объёма и рабочей ресурса.

Оперативность подключения к данным является жизненно ключевым характеристикой работы баз данных. Клиенты рассчитывают на мгновенных результатов на запросы даже при анализе миллионов данных. Индексирование таблиц даёт возможность обнаруживать нужные информацию за мгновения секунды.

Сохранение систематически запрашиваемых данных ускоряет функционирование программ. База данных удерживает частые команды в оперативной ресурсе для немедленного подключения. Уменьшает напряжение на накопительную компоненту и увеличивает производительность платформы.

Распределённые базы данных располагают сведения на нескольких серверах. Такая конфигурация гарантирует линейное расширение и управление увеличивающихся массивов информации.

Отношения между сведениями и принцип их организации

Взаимосвязи между схемами составляют основу структурированных баз данных. Разные форматы данных сцепляются через специализированные ключевые столбцы, образуя целостную платформу. ап икс гарантирует логическую целостность и синхронность всей структуры.

Внешние коды устанавливают связи между таблицами. Поле в одной таблице указывает на первичный код другой матрицы, образуя соединение между данными. Такая организация обеспечивает хранить сведения о клиентах независимо от сведений о операциях.

Базы данных реализуют несколько видов соединений между матрицами:

  • Один к одному — каждая элемент привязана с единой записью
  • Один ко многим — одна строка связана с несколькими записями
  • Многие ко многим — различные строки соединены между собой

Нормализация данных ликвидирует дублирование и совершенствует организацию базы. Распределяет информацию на логические блоки и устанавливает корректные соединения. Метод упорядочения увеличивает продуктивность размещения данных.

Использование баз данных в ежедневных сервисах

Базы данных функционируют в фоновом состоянии почти каждого онлайн приложения. Социальные сети сохраняют страницы клиентов, изображения и записи в гигантских базах данных. Каждое операция — добавление сообщения или реплика — сохраняется в платформу и оказывается видимым для прочих клиентов.

Интернет-магазины используют базы данных для контроля перечнями позиций и выполнения заказов. ап икс официальный сайт позволяет немедленно изменять информацию о присутствии продукции и показывать свежие цены. Комплексы советов обрабатывают историю приобретений и показывают продукты на основе вкусов.

Банковские программы переработывают миллионы платежей ежесуточно. База данных записывает каждый транзит и выплату с точностью до копейки. Подтверждает безопасность денежной сведений и блокирует несанкционированный проникновение.

Навигационные службы размещают атласы и данные о затруднениях в профильных базах. Платформы заказа организуют присутствием билетов и обрабатывают заказы в формате текущего времени.

Безопасность и обеспечение сведений в базах данных

Обеспечение информации является собой ключевую цель каждой комплекса контроля базами. Конфиденциальная сведения покупателей и финансовые данные запрашивают устойчивой защиты от незаконного обращения. Комплексная система охраны контролирует каждое подключение к информации.

Верификация участников устанавливает идентичность каждого, кто подключается к базе данных. Комплексы требуют ввода идентификатора и пароля, а также могут применять двухэтапную проверку. up x разделяет права обращения для разных классов участников.

Криптование информации предохраняет сведения при хранении и передаче по линии. База данных трансформирует доступный данные в закодированный код, который невозможно интерпретировать без уникального шифра. Обеспечивает секретность даже при физическом доступе к хостам.

Журналирование процессов записывает все шаги участников в базе данных. Механизм регистрирует время подключения и завершённые команды. Мониторинг позволяет отследить подозрительную действия.

Актуализация и согласование сведений в мгновенном времени

Нынешние базы данных переработывают модификации данных мгновенно. Когда пользователь корректирует профиль или совершает покупку, механизм моментально записывает обновлённые информацию. up-x гарантирует современность информации для каждого участников совместно.

Согласование данных между несколькими узлами поддерживает целостность децентрализованных платформ. Правки, внесённые на одном узле, самостоятельно копируются на остальные машины. ап икс блокирует разночтения в сведениях и предоставляет унификацию информации.

Коллизии при синхронном модификации идентичных и тех же данных устраняются особыми механизмами. База данных фиксирует данные на период актуализации или эксплуатирует позитивную тактику управления. Комплекс контролирует итерации сведений и исключает утрату изменений.

Тиражирование сведений формирует копии базы на географически разнесённых машинах. Клиенты получают доступ к близлежащему машине, что понижает лаги. Повышает отказоустойчивость структуры при отказах техники.

Архивное сохранение и регенерация данных

Дублирующее дублирование оберегает базы данных от утраты чрезвычайно важной информации. Системы самостоятельно генерируют дубликаты сведений через назначенные интервалы времени. Дублирующие реплики располагаются на обособленных носителях или внешних серверах.

Полное сохранение генерирует отпечаток целой базы данных в определённый миг времени. Такие копии дают возможность реконструировать комплекс полностью. Осуществляет целое дублирование каждую неделю или помесячно в отношении от размера данных.

Инкрементное сохранение удерживает только модификации, произошедшие с момента прошлой резервной реплики. Такой подход сберегает ресурс на дисках и улучшает операцию. Совмещает целое и частичное копирование для эффективного баланса.

Реконструкция данных возвращает базу в операционное форму после аварий или погрешностей. Специалисты выбирают требуемую архивную дубликат и запускают процедуру возврата. ап икс официальный сайт снижает срок бездействия и исчезновение сведений при критических ситуациях.

Значение баз данных в деятельности современных сервисов и порталов

Базы данных образуют базис произвольного современного интернет-программы или карманного службы. Без структур управления сведениями неосуществима функционирование цифровых площадок, которыми используют миллиарды пользователей ежедневно. Каждый касание или действие участника контактирует с базой данных.

Интерактивный наполнение площадок генерируется на базе информации из баз данных. Медийные порталы выбирают публикации, обсуждения отображают записи, а видеоплатформы извлекают метаданные клипов. Это позволяет формировать настроенный наполнение для каждого посетителя.

Мобильные программы согласовывают сведения с удалёнными базами для гарантирования доступа с отличающихся девайсов. Пользователь запускает взаимодействие на мобильнике и ведёт на планшете без исчезновения продвижения. ап икс осуществляет бесшовный восприятие применения на разнообразии систем.

Исследовательские механизмы выполняют сведения из баз для выработки управленческих выводов. Корпорации исследуют манеру участников и предвидят спрос. ап икс официальный сайт преобразует исходные сведения в важные инсайты для улучшения изделий.

Comments are closed